Hallo zusammen!
Ich schreibe gerade meine Diplomarbeit und nutze hierzu zum ersten Mal STATA. Heute ist ein Problem aufgetaucht, dass ich einfach nicht gelöst bekomme. Prinzipiell geht es um die Berechnung eines Umrechnungsfaktors. Hierzu muss ich zunächst mit Hilfe des egen-Befehls die Summe aller Mitarbeiter von verschiedenen Unternehmen bilden. Mein Befehl lautet in etwa wie folgt:
egen total_teiln_pers_9 =total(m83ges) if m82==1 & m01svb05 > 499 & m01svb05 < 2000 & ostdeutl ==0 & verarb_gew == 1
Dieser Wert wird nun lediglich bei den Fällen in die Spalte eingetragen, die die if-Bedingung erfüllen. Ich würde den entsprechenden Wert aber gerne auf alle Fälle meines Datensatzes übertragen. Wie kann ich das tun?
Mein Problem ist, dass ich die Daten im Rahmen einer Datenfernverarbeitung auswerten muss, d.h. ich kann in der Datenmatrix weder den Ergebniswert des egen-Befehls nachsehen, noch weiß ich für welche Fälle der egen-Befehl einen Wert ergibt.
Prinzipiell suche ich also folgende Anweisung:
"Übertrage den einheitlichen Wert, der mit Hilfe des egen-Befehls berechnet wird auch auf die Fälle, für die die mit dem egen-Befehl erstellte Variable einen Missing darstellt".
Für Hilfe wäre ich wirklich sehr dankbar!
Viele Grüße
statistikneuling